Militants launched 5 attacks on Ukrainian troops in Donbas in last day

Militants launched 5 attacks on Ukrainian positions, using weapons banned under the Minsk agreements twice, in the Joint Forces Operation (JFO) area in Donbas over the past day.

“The enemy fired 120mm and 82mm mortars on JFO positions near Krymske (42.5km north-west of Luhansk), 82mm mortars – outside Zolote-4 (59km north-west of Luhansk) ,” reads the report of the JFO Headquarters press center.

Militants also used grenade launchers, heavy machine guns and small arms to shell Ukrainian troops near Novotoshkivske (53km north-west of Luhansk), Stanytsia Luhanska (16km north-east of Luhansk) and Avdiivka (18km north of Donetsk).

One Ukrainian serviceman was wounded over the past day.

According to the intelligence, one invader was killed and two more were wounded on December 26.

Today, the enemy has already shelled Ukrainian positions near Hnutove (19km north-west of Mariupol), using grenade launchers and heavy machine guns.
